Output 2819858583a068c7b07d8351ada497a7064f48022cb27e7347de2016b7153708:0

value
3740275
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44ab3f7b76ae5a96a5d48323df42b776c84d372c OP_EQUALVERIFY OP_CHECKSIG
address
17G66ZdRTaXDsN5kQ2hjLXjaZVQGoRTsDe
transaction
2819858583a068c7b07d8351ada497a7064f48022cb27e7347de2016b7153708
spent
true